Shropshire Gardens is situated on the ever so popular Shires estate, which is located on the outskirts of St Helens town centre. The nearby Ravenhead Retail Park is close by for added convenience.
St Helens Central train station is nearby - this ensures you have great rail connections to Liverpool, Wigan and up to Blackpool.
The A58 provides you direct access in and out of the town, heading to Prescot and Liverpool in the West and down through Sutton to the M62 in the South - this then connects further to North Manchester, the M6 for Cheshire, the Lakes and the Midlands, and over the Pennines to Yorkshire.
